INGREDIENTS
Brine Base
- 1 gallon vegetable broth
- 🧂 1 cup kosher salt
- ½ cup light brown sugar
- 🌶 1 tablespoon black peppercorns
- 1 ½ teaspoons whole allspice berries
- 1 ½ teaspoons chopped candied ginger
Additional Liquids and Ice
- 🧊 1 gallon water with ice chunks
- 1 cup water
Flavor Additions
- 🍎 1 medium red apple, cored and sliced
- 🧅 ½ medium onion, sliced
- 1 (3 inch) cinnamon stick
- 🌿 4 sprigs fresh rosemary
- 6 leaves fresh sage
STEPS
Gather all ingredients.
Combine vegetable broth, kosher salt, brown sugar, peppercorns, allspice berries, and candied ginger in a large stockpot over medium-high heat. Stir to dissolve sugar and salt; bring mixture to a boil.
Remove from the heat and cool to room temperature. Cover and refrigerate until well chilled, at least 4 hours.
Remove from refrigerator and add water with ice chunks, apple and onion slices, cinnamon stick, rosemary sprigs, and sage leaves. Stir in remaining 1 cup water and brine is ready to use.

💡 Ensure the brine is well chilled before using to avoid bacterial contamination.Use a food-grade stockpot for safety.This brine can be prepared a day in advance to save time during holiday preparation.
